Mesothelioma is a type of cancer that develops in the tissues that line body cavities, such as the abdomen and lungs. It can take years to diagnose the disease, and often, it's fatal. Asbestos victims, and their families, are entitled to compensation for their losses. This includes future and past medical expenses.

Mesothelioma is a form of cancer that is caused by exposure to asbestos. This is a toxic substance that was employed in the construction and manufacturing industries for many years. Workers in these fields were exposed to asbestos fibers, which can be inhaled and then lodged into the lungs and tissues. This can lead to various diseases, including mesothelioma.
